Kwara: Extend Charity To Less Privileged – Emir Charges Muslims

Date: 2023-03-23

The Emir of Ilorin and Chairman Kwara State Council of Chiefs, Alhaji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ari, has urged Muslims in Ilorin Emirate to extend charity and support to the less privileged throughout the month of Ramadan and enjoined them to commence this year's fasting tomorrow (Thursday).

He spoke on Wednesday night at a joint meeting of the Ilorin Emirate Council and the Council of Ulama, held in the ancient palace of Ilorin.

This followed the physical sighting of the new crescent moon in Ilorin town on Wednesday night.

The Emir, in a statement issued by his spokesman, Mallam Abdulazeez Arowona, confirmed that the new crescent moon was physically sighted in Ilorin, the Kwara State capital and a call was also put across to inform His Eminence, the Sultan of Sokoto, Muhammad Sa'ad Abubakar, for his further directives.

Alhaji Sulu-Gambari thanked Allah for His mercies on the people of the Ilorin Emirate and humanity at large.

He urged the Muslim Ummah to use the month of Ramadan to move closer to Almighty Allah by engaging in good deeds, charity, humanitarian services and supplications, as well as seeking forgiveness at all times.

“As we commence this year's Ramadan fasting, the annual Ramadan lecture (Tafsir) will commence at the Madrasatul Sheik Alimi inside the Emir's Palace on Monday 27th March 2023, beginning from (09:00 GMT) 10am local time everyday,” the Emir added.

He, also used the occasion to congratulate Muslims for witnessing another glorious month of Ramadan, stressing that such privilege should be used to foster peaceful co-existence among religious adherents in the state.
